Subd. 43. Boating: <br />a. No person may on any lake, pond or sAream within the City use any mechanically <br />propelled watercraft unless being used for emergency rescue or the maintenance of the <br />lake, pond or stream. <br />b. No person may operate any watercraft on any open space waters contrary to or in <br />violation of State law. <br />C. No person may operate, row or paddle a boat, canoe or other watercraft on any open <br />space waters unless able to handle the same with safety to themselves, other occupants, or <br />in such manner as not to annoy or endanger the occupants of other boats. <br />d. No person may leave any watercraft unattended except in areas specifically <br />designated for mooring, anchoring or beaching. <br />e. No person may operate watercraft within an area which has been designated as a <br />swimming area. <br />f. No person may drop or throw from any watercraft garbage, litter or other debris. <br />g. All watercraft launched from a system facility or operating on open space waters must <br />have a Coast Guard -approved life preserver for each occupant. <br />h. No person may operate any watercraft in a careless or reckless manner. <br />Subd. 34. Motorized Recreation Vehicle: <br />a. No person shall operate a motorized recreation vehicle within any open space site <br />except in such areas specifically designated for such use. <br />b. No person may operate a nonlicensed vehicle on any parkway or other roadway <br />within an open space site. <br />C. No person may place any vehicle for sale or exchange on park property. <br />d. No person may wash, grease, repair, change oil or maintain in any way a vehicle <br />except as necessary in an emergency. <br />Subd. 65. Camping: No person may establish or maintain any camp or other temporary lodging <br />or sleeping place in any open space site. <br />5546580 DTA MU210-54 to <br />
